The logistics consulting services market in China is growing rapidly, driven by the nation's economic expansion, increased international trade, and advances in technology. As businesses face the complexities of managing logistics operations, from warehousing and transportation to inventory management and supply chain optimization, the need for expert consulting services has become more critical. The China logistics consulting services market, categorized by application, is segmented into various verticals including large enterprises and small-to-medium enterprises (SMEs). These segments require tailored approaches to logistics challenges, with large enterprises seeking advanced, integrated solutions, while SMEs often seek cost-effective, scalable logistics strategies. The growing demand for logistics consulting is also a result of China’s strategic initiatives to improve its infrastructure and logistics efficiency, offering vast opportunities for consulting firms.

The large enterprise segment in the China logistics consulting services market represents a significant portion of the overall market due to the scale and complexity of operations involved. These enterprises often operate on a global scale and require sophisticated logistics strategies to manage vast supply chains, international trade compliance, and multi-modal transportation. Consulting services for large enterprises typically focus on optimizing their supply chain management systems, integrating technology solutions like automation, artificial intelligence (AI), and Internet of Things (IoT) to streamline operations and enhance productivity. Furthermore, logistics consultants help these organizations navigate challenges such as geopolitical factors, regulations, and fluctuations in global supply chains, ensuring they remain competitive in the dynamic market environment.
Consultants in the large enterprise segment are tasked with delivering customized, comprehensive solutions that integrate data analytics and technology to enhance operational efficiency. These solutions often involve the redesign of transportation networks, warehouse management systems, and inventory processes to optimize throughput and minimize costs. Large enterprises demand high-quality, end-to-end solutions that can scale with their growth and support their global operations. As China continues to expand its economic influence globally, the need for advanced logistics consulting services tailored to large enterprises is expected to increase, making this segment one of the key drivers of growth in the market.
The small-to-medium enterprises (SMEs) segment in the China logistics consulting services market represents a diverse and dynamic group that has different logistics needs compared to large enterprises. SMEs typically require more flexible, cost-effective solutions that allow them to optimize their logistics operations without the need for large capital investments in technology or infrastructure. Consultants who specialize in serving SMEs offer tailored services that focus on streamlining supply chains, improving transportation and delivery efficiency, and ensuring compliance with local and international regulations. Many SMEs are also exploring e-commerce platforms and direct-to-consumer models, which creates additional complexity in their logistics operations.
For SMEs, the primary focus of logistics consulting is on scalability and cost-efficiency. These businesses often face budgetary constraints and need affordable solutions to improve their operational effectiveness. The growth of digital technologies, such as cloud computing and software-as-a-service (SaaS) logistics platforms, has enabled SMEs to access advanced tools for managing inventory, tracking shipments, and optimizing delivery routes, without significant upfront investments. As a result, logistics consultants in this space often focus on providing SMEs with the tools and strategies they need to compete with larger organizations, while keeping operational costs manageable and improving customer satisfaction.
One of the key trends in the China logistics consulting services market is the increasing adoption of digital technologies such as Artificial Int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and big data analytics. These technologies enable logistics firms and their consultants to optimize operations, predict supply chain disruptions, and provide more personalized solutions for their clients. AI and ML are used to analyze data from various sources, offering insights that help in route planning, inventory management, and demand forecasting. Furthermore, the rise of e-commerce in China has driven an increase in demand for logistics consulting services, as businesses seek ways to optimize last-mile delivery and improve customer service in the face of growing competition.
Another significant trend is the shift towards sustainable logistics practices. With the Chinese government placing greater emphasis on environmental sustainability, logistics firms and consultants are focusing on reducing carbon emissions, optimizing packaging, and adopting green technologies in supply chains. This trend includes the development of eco-friendly transportation networks, the use of electric vehicles (EVs), and the implementation of energy-efficient warehousing solutions. As environmental regulations become stricter and consumers demand more sustainable business practices, logistics consulting firms are playing a crucial role in helping businesses meet these challenges while maintaining operational efficiency and reducing costs.
The China logistics consulting services market is poised for significant growth due to several emerging opportunities. First, the country’s Belt and Road Initiative (BRI) has created new avenues for logistics consulting firms to support businesses involved in international trade. The BRI’s infrastructure development projects are increasing the need for sophisticated logistics solutions to manage cross-border supply chains, making it a critical area for logistics consultants to provide expertise. In addition, the expansion of China's e-commerce industry, particularly in cities like Beijing, Shanghai, and Shenzhen, presents a growing demand for logistics consulting services to support the rapid growth of online shopping and last-mile delivery optimization.
Furthermore, the rise of Industry 4.0, characterized by automation, robotics, and IoT, presents significant opportunities for logistics consultants. These technologies allow businesses to streamline operations, reduce costs, and improve supply chain transparency. Consultants who can help organizations navigate these technological advancements and integrate them into their logistics operations will be in high demand. As the Chinese government continues to invest in infrastructure and digital transformation, logistics consulting firms have an opportunity to capitalize on these trends by offering cutting-edge solutions that improve efficiency, enhance customer experiences, and support sustainable growth in the logistics sector.
